In the summer of 1989, I was working in a studio in Silver Spring with assorted drum machines, a Prophet 600 with its arpeggiator, and some outboard gear. This track was one of the resulting pieces.
The title came from the name of one of my composition students at the time. He had submitted some pieces, but they had nothing to do with the piece I called by his name. Rather, I found myself in the melting pot of the DC metropolitan area, meeting people from all over the world. I was celebrating the diversity and making something to spur my students on.
